Overview
T-Drive Testosterone Support combines several vitamins, minerals, and herbal extracts that are claimed to boost testosterone levels and overall performance. While some ingredients like Vitamin D, Magnesium, Zinc, and KSM-66 Ashwagandha have research supporting their individual benefits, the overall effectiveness of the product is limited by the lack of strong evidence for many of the other ingredients and the proprietary blend, which makes it impossible to assess the exact dosages of each ingredient.
